Former MMA fighter Anthony Taylor has opened up about his dream move into WWE’s world of sports entertainment, which includes getting a tryout for the organisation.

In an exclusive interview with Esports Insider, the Misfits fighter, who has faced off against Tommy Fury, Salt Papi and Daren Till has WWE in his sights with the 36-year-old preparing to prove himself for the right to enter the squared circle.

However, he doesn’t want to make the move alone. Taylor plans to learn from how Logan Paul has emerged as a legit performer in WWE, and he wants Logan’s brother, Jake Paul, as his future tag team partner based on their chemistry sparring in the gym together.

“I’ve just found out I’ve been given a WWE tryout,” Taylor told Esports Insider. “I’m fired up like never before. 

“This is the moment I’ve been working towards my whole career. Every fight, every show, every crowd I’ve entertained has led to this.  

“To even get the chance to prove myself on the WWE stage is huge, but I’m coming in with the mindset to not just impress, but to earn my spot. I know what I bring to the table, and I’m ready to show the world that Anthony Taylor belongs in WWE.”

According to Taylor, his dream of joining WWE wasn’t only born from watching wrestling on TV but also playing the official WWE game, now published by 2K.

“It would be a childhood dream fulfilled,” he added. “Can you imagine it, this time next year you load up WWE 2K26 and Anthony Taylor is a playable character, that would be a pinch me moment.”

Logan Paul has Shown the Way

When looking at the world of WWE, many athletes have transitioned into the world of sport entertainment. However, perhaps one of the more recent, high-profile transitions was from that of YouTube personality Logan Paul. In 2023, following sporadic appearances for the WWE, Paul signed a multi-year contract with the wrestling promotion.

“What Logan Paul has done in WWE is nothing short of incredible,” said Taylor. “He’s proved that if you have the athletic ability, the dedication, and the personality to connect with the fans, you can walk in from another sport and earn respect in the wrestling world. 

“I look at his journey and see a blueprint but I also see an opportunity to put my own twist on it. I’ve built my name in combat sports through skill, confidence, and entertainment, and I know that combination is exactly what WWE is all about. I’m not just coming to follow Logan’s path but to create my own.”

I was Jake Paul’s Sparring Partner — He can be my WWE Tag Team Partner

In the interview, Taylor also discussed the possibility of teaming up with Logan Paul’s brother, Jake Paul, who has gone on to compete in various boxing exhibitions. This included going toe-to-toe with boxing legend Mike Tyson in November last year.

Taylor said: “People forget that before all the bright lights and big events, I was Jake Paul’s sparring partner. 

“I was there in the gym, putting in the rounds, helping him sharpen the tools that made him a star in boxing. We’ve always had a competitive edge with each other, but there’s also a real respect and chemistry there. 

“One day, I’d love to bring that energy into WWE as a tag team. Imagine the two of us — both with fight experience, both with the ability to hype a crowd — walking down that ramp. We wouldn’t just compete; we’d take over the tag division.”
